Cholinergic Receptor Muscarinic 1 (CHRM1) is a G protein-coupled receptor expressed in both the central and peripheral nervous systems (CNS and PNS). The degeneration of cholinergic neurons and cholinergic hypofunction are pathologies associated with Alzheimer's disease (AD). Our recent studies have demonstrated a severe loss (≥50% decrease compared to non-demented individuals) of CHRM1 protein levels in the postmortem temporal cortices, which is associated with poor survival in AD patients. Antibiotic resistance is a global threat, claiming approximately five million lives annually and impacting nations worldwide. In the U.S.A., this issue is significant, with 2.8 million diagnosed cases leading to 35,000 deaths each year. One way that bacteria can resist antibiotic treatment is through the inoculum effect (IE). IE explains how the concentration of antibiotics required to kill a population of bacteria increases as a function of bacterial density. Shallow water (<10m depth) coastal benthic invertebrate communities in the Galápagos Archipelago are well-described. However, the submerged Concha de Perla lava tunnel is undescribed, despite being at a main tourist area in a lagoon near (~150m east) the main dock for the town of Puerto Villamil, Isabela Island. The tunnel is oriented along an east-west axis, is ~15m long, with an interior diameter of ~2m. This creates habitat for cavernicolous fauna in the interior, with more typical benthic cover at the entrances. Red mangrove (Rhizophora mangle) trees surround and grow on top of the tunnel. Benthic cover on the tunnel interior includes sponges, cnidarians, sea urchins and bryozoans. The most common invertebrates include the endemic sea urchin Eucidaris galapagensis, white sponges, bryozoans and the azooxanthellate orange cup coral Tubastrea coccinea. Algae is absent except for a patch of crustose coralline algae on the northern wall near the west opening that receives dim light in the late afternoons. Cerebral amyloid angiopathy (CAA), characterized by the accumulation of amyloid protein in cerebral vessels, is linked to Alzheimer's disease (AD), stroke, and cognitive impairment. Currently, there is no effective treatment or prevention for this condition. The ketogenic diet (KD), which is characterized by high fat, low carbohydrate, and moderate protein consumption, has gained considerable attention in recent years for its potential therapeutic use in patients with neurodegenerative diseases. Studies in AD rodent models have found that KD and/or ketogenic supplements attenuate cognitive-behavioral impairments and dementia-related pathology. Persistent organic pollutants (POPs) are characterized by their biologically accumulative nature, toxicity to organisms, and persistence in the environment. The physical and chemical properties of these “forever chemicals” enhance their capacity for global transport, and the ocean serves as their ultimate sink. The Eastern Pacific stock of northern fur seals (Callorhinus ursinus) on the Pribilof Islands, Alaska, represents of 70% of the global breeding population but has been experiencing a discontinuous decline since 1980. Understanding how ecosystems in the Great Plains responded to droughts and prehistoric climate change is important for interpreting future climate disturbances and water resource planning. There is a correlation between glacial periods and atmospheric dust distribution, with significant dust deposition in the Great Plains during the Last Glacial Maximum, ~23,000 years ago (23ka). Continuous freezing and thawing events in the mid-continent led to erosion in the Great Plains, transporting a significant deposit of windblown dust, or loess, and an ecological collapse of the grassland ecosystems. Transposons, also known as transposable elements, are dynamic DNA segments that have the ability to shift locations within a genome, impacting gene regulation, evolutionary processes, and genomic stability. TEs play vital roles in genetic research. They provide pathways for precise genetic alterations and mutagenesis, which facilitate the investigation of gene function and disease mechanisms in many organisms.
